Is there a way to switch off the task pane at start up - unchecking the
checkbox in Tools>Options>View> Startup Task Pane does not have any effect.

In Word 2002, in the New Document Task Pane, clear the checkbox entitled
"Show at startup" at the bottom of the task pane.
